| Technical Topics Acceleration - acceleration sensitivity of quartz crystal resonators, resonators propensity to change frequency with acceleration. Aging - the systematic gradual change in frequency over time. Angle & Tolerance - angle of cut, Angle Rotation and tolerance in quartz crystals. Calibration & Calibration Tolerance - the adjustment the frequency of vibration to the design frequency called out by the specification. Capacitance - electrode capacitance, holder capacitance, and shunt capacitance. Crystal Blanks - the quartz wafer exclusive of any mounting structure or hermetic package. Crystal Holders - diagrams of various crystal holders. Cut - quartz crystal cuts; AT cuts, BT cuts and SC cuts. DRAT - Doubly Rotated AT Cut Crystals. Doubly Rotated AT-DRATS - Doubly Rotated AT Cut Crystals. Drive Level - the power level applied to a quartz crystal during oscillation. Frequency - the crystal's vibration mode (fundamental or overtone), the harmonics of that mode, and the physical dimensions of the quartz plate. Frequency vs Mode - vibrating quartz crystal has a number of modes being excited simultaneously Frequency vs. Package Size - chart providing the lower fundamental frequency limit for a specific holder type. Frequency Stability - The change in frequency over temperature is usually expressed in PPM/degree Celsius and is referred to as frequency stability or temperature coefficient. G Sensitivity - the frequency of the resonator is affected by gravity. Holders - hermetically sealed package types. Hysteresis - Retrace - Hysteresis or retrace is a resonator's repeatability of its frequency vs. temperature characteristic. Inflection Point - the point on the Frequency vs. Temperature curve where the change in frequency changes from positive to negative. Inversion Or Turn Points - the two inversion points, the Lower Inversion Point and the Upper Inversion Point. Metal Holders - HC Types - metal holders HC-types are through-hole devices available with either leads or pins. Military Quartz Crystals - crystals designed, manufactured and qualified to military specification MIL-PRF-3098/H Motional Capacitance & Motional Inductance - motional capacitance and motional inductance in crystal designs for oscillators. Quality Factor - Q factor, the ratio of the energy stored per cycle vs. the energy dissipated in a cycle. Perturbations - Dips - the effect of temperature dependent mode coupling. Called perturbations, band-breaks or activity dips. PIND - Particle Impact Noise Detection - the test to detect extraneous solid material. Phase Noise - random phase modulation which is present in quartz crystal oscillator. Resistance - the impedance of the crystal, measured in ohms at series resonance. Series & Parallel Resonance - series and parallel resonance of crystals. Shock - mechanical shock and thermal shock for crystals. Short Term Stability - short term stability - change of frequency typically exhibited per day. Specifying Frequency Stability - Frequency stability or temperature coefficient has two elements, frequency change (deviation) and temperature range. Spurious Modes - inharmonic modes of vibration in the quartz plate. Surface Mount Packages - there are a number of surface mount options available, some derived from metal HC-types and others in metal/plastic and ceramic packages. Vibration - crystal vibrational anomalies in a vibrating environment. |
